Bright and Sunny California Quinoa Salad

Let me share with you a delicious recipe for an awesome and nutritiously dense way to get your protein. With 11g of protein and 8g of fibre per serving, you know it's going to be satisfying... and it's so good for you.

Quinoa is a great grain alternative. The protein in quinoa is complete, meaning that it contains all the essential protein building blocks that our bodies need. The addition of edemame and almonds just adds even more protein, but what I think makes this salad so delicious is the lime zest, it makes it bright and sunny.... just like California!

California Quinoa Salad
(adapted from http://damndelicious.net/2014/06/07/whole-foods-california-quinoa-salad/)

Ingredients
  • 1 cup quinoa
  • 1/4 cup balsamic vinegar
  • Zest of 2 limes
  • 1 mango, peeled and diced
  • 1 red bell pepper, diced
  • 1/2 cup shelled edamame
  • 1/3 cup chopped red onion
  • 1/4 cup unsweetened coconut flakes
  • 1/4 cup sliced almonds
  • 1/4 cup raisins
  • 2 tablespoons chopped fresh cilantro leaves


Instructions

In a large saucepan of 2 cups water, cook quinoa according to package instructions; set aside.
In a small bowl, whisk together balsamic vinegar and lime zest; set aside.
In a large bowl, combine quinoa, mango, bell pepper, edamame, red onion, coconut flakes, almonds, raisins and cilantro. Pour the balsamic vinegar mixture on top of the salad and gently toss to combine.
Serve immediately.
